OpenAI has finalized a significant agreement with the US Department of Defense (DoD) to integrate its AI models within the Pentagon’s classified network, following a recent dispute involving competitor Anthropic. OpenAI CEO Sam Altman announced the deal on X, emphasizing alignment on safety principles, particularly against domestic mass surveillance and ensuring human accountability in the use of force, including autonomous weapons systems. This agreement comes after Defense Secretary Pete Hegseth labeled Anthropic a supply chain risk to national security, preventing military contractors from collaborating with the company amid concerns raised by former President Trump. Additionally, Altman urged the Pentagon to extend similar conditions to all AI firms, ensuring safety standards are upheld. OpenAI promises to implement technical safeguards to ensure its models operate responsibly.
